/fukura/


  • verb
  • dialects/origins: Manyika
English translation
To hollow out; to form cavity or hole in; to make hollow by cutting, scooping, or digging; as, to excavate a ball; to excavate the earth.
Imperative example
Shona English
fukura excavate (singular)
fukurai excavate (plural)
Simple future tense example
Shona English
Ndicha fukura I will excavate
ucha fukura you will excavate (singular)
mucha fukura you will excavate (plural)
acha fukura he/she will excavate
ticha fukura we will excavate
vacha fukura they will excavate
chicha fukura it will excavate
